There is no direct connection from Tel Aviv to Cremona. However, you can take the train to נתב''ג, walk to Ben Gurion Airport (TLV) airport, fly to Milan Linate Airport (LIN), walk to Linate Aeroporto, take the line 4 subway to Stazione Forlanini, walk to Milano Forlanini, take the train to Milano Lambrate, then take the train to Cremona. Alternatively, you can take the train to נתב''ג, walk to Ben Gurion Airport (TLV) airport, fly to Verona Villafranca Airport (VRN), walk to Verona - Aeroporto, then take the shuttle to Cremona hospital.
